I figure someone has got to do it, so I have taken it upon myself to review every one of Senmuth's 78 (and counting) albums. For those who don't know about the man's work, Senmuth is a one man band whose work crosses ethic, industrial, and metal boundaries. The guy makes about an album a month, for the past six years.
I dare you to take the Senmuth challenge with me! All of his albums are free for download, in a few different places.. |
